Understanding SAP Uni Wien
SAP University Alliances is a global program designed to bridge the gap between academia and the professional world. By providing students and faculty with access to SAP software and resources, the program aims to equip participants with the skills needed to succeed in the digital economy. The University of Vienna is one of the many institutions worldwide that has joined this initiative.
